Burgundy can also be slightly abrasive when it comes to her job as seen when she told Ash to replace all of his Pokémon. Also, she can be too invasive with the Pokémon she evaluates, causing them to attack her. When speaking, she tends to use an array of French words and phrases, some of which are mispronounced. This may be her attempting to appear elegant and graceful.


Though she pretends that she does not wish to learn anything from Cilan, Burgundy always pays the most attention to him whenever he evaluates a Pokémon.
